  • I didn't think I was going to get one, but I'm getting one at 32 weeks because I have a fibroid. It's small (never even knew I had it pre pregnancy), but my OB said sometimes they start taking the blood flow from the baby & she just wants to make sure that's not happening. My doctor follows things pretty closely which makes me happy. That's the only reason I'm getting one though.

    With the military, unless there is a problem they don't do another ultra sound after your 20 week a/s at least from what I've been told/experienced. I had to get a second one at 28 weeks due to having placenta lakes and also to check on a family history problem but that ultra sound I had to get a referral/approval from tricare.

    It's sucks but especially with so many women being pregnant in the military system and all I'm sure the insurance wants to cover as little as possible since they have to pay for so many already. But you can always try it never hurts to ask. Also available are the 3d ultra sounds but like the others have said its out of pocket and prices vary.
